Hurst, James Kendall was born on October 17, 1940 in Maquoketa, Iowa, United States. Son of Ernst Paul and Mary Eleanor (Bacon) Albrecht.
Bachelor cum laude, Cornell College, 1962; Doctor of Philosophy, Stanford University, 1966.
Postdoctoral fellow, Cornell Univercity, Ithaca, New York, 1966-1969; assistant professor of chemistry, Oregon Graduate Center, Beaverton, 1969-1973; associate professor, Oregon Graduate Center, Beaverton, 1973-1979; professor, Oregon Graduate Center, Beaverton, since 1979; chairman, Oregon Graduate Center, Beaverton, 1979-1983. Visiting professor Ecole Polytechnique Federale, Lausanne, Switzerland, 1980-1981, 85-86. Consultant McDonnell-Douglas, St. Louis, 1980-1982.
Secretary Portland (Oregon) Chemists Supporting the Pauling Award Committee, 1982-1985. Member American Chemical Society, Phi Beta Kappa.
Married Karen Sue Elder, June 12, 1966. Children: Harvey, Vincent.
